VOMITOR - PESTILENT DEATH review 02/23/2018 We have here Vomitor's fourth album of raunchy alcohol-fueled and adrenaline-pumping thrashing death released on the much revered label Hells Headbangers, and per usual there isn't a remote hint of fucking around or clown game to be found. Equal parts blasphemy, rage, and general animosity, Vomitor have conjured up one cruel ode to misanthropy that summons the spirits of the finest classic death and thrash from all over the globe.
